Portfolio Exposure and ETF Strategy Overview

The Amplify SILJ Junior Silver Miners Covered Call ETF seeks to balance high income and capital appreciation through investment exposure to junior silver mining companies and a covered call strategy. The fund achieves this exposure primarily via holdings in the Amplify Junior Silver Miners ETF (SILJ), select underlying equities from that portfolio, and silver exchange-traded products. It employs a tactical out-of-the-money covered call options writing approach to monetize volatility and generate option premium income.

Top holdings typically feature significant allocation to SILJ itself, alongside individual silver miners such as Hecla Mining Company (HL), First Majestic Silver Corp (AG), and others in the basic materials sector. Geographic exposure centers on North American and international silver producers, with market-cap weighting favoring mid- and large-cap names within the junior silver space. This positioning structurally ties the ETF’s performance to silver price movements, mining operational leverage, and options income generation, positioning it for potential total return in environments favoring both commodity strength and income strategies.
